GreatWater is expanding its presence through its recent acquisition of Clutch Automotive, a seven-location automotive repair and service business in the Houston, Texas, area.
The acquisition marks GreatWater’s entry into the Houston market and brings the company to 170 locations across its growing network, according to officials.
Clutch Automotive will keep its name, leadership and shop teams remaining in place.
Matthew Schwab, the shop's founder and former owner, will continue working with GreatWater as an acquisition consultant, "supporting future growth opportunities in the Houston market."
Andrew Boone will join GreatWater as district manager for Houston, and Trent Barger will join as director of integration, "a critical role as the company onboards the Clutch shops and evaluates future acquisitions in the region."
GreatWater officials say keeping Clutch’s leadership team is vital for entering a new market, which preserves "the operating rhythm, team culture, customer relationships and local knowledge that made Clutch Automotive successful while connecting the shops to the broader GreatWater platform."

GreatWater will provide Clutch Automotive with an operating support platform, including resources across operations, recruiting, technician development, procurement, finance, marketing, technology and training.
Officials say the acquisition builds on GreatWater's strategy of "strengthening local shops through the resources of a broader operating platform."
GreatWater 360 Auto Care, based in Grand Rapids, Mich., is one of the largest tire dealerships in the U.S., according to the 2026 MTD 100.
